Hi plugin folks — the cut-over for Thistlebox is done. Root cause of the stale-cache bug: our invalidation hook skipped entries written during deploys, so plugins saw old manifests for up to an hour. We've shortened TTLs and added a version check on read. Please retest against the new cache settings shown below.

settings of bawif-fawif:
ralix:
  log_level: warn
  metrics_host: metrics.ralix.tolvaqsys.internal
  pool_size: 32

TURN-208: Gatevale turnstile counters at the Merrow Field pilot double-count when a rotation reverses mid-cycle. Attendance totals drift roughly 2% high per event. The debounce window fix is implemented, reviewed by Ilsa, and soak-tested across two simulated match days without drift. Ready for your cut; the candidate build is identified below.

trace token, tagag-tafog: htk6_5ed18c

### Step 4: Wire up Dedupe Creds

Quick one for the sync — Quellhorn, our alert deduplicator, is ready to ship to staging. It collapses duplicate pages before they hit the on-call rotation, so Marit's team stops getting triple-paged at 3am. Deploy is the usual: pull the `quellhorn-deploy` chart, set `DEDUPE_WINDOW_SECONDS=120`, and confirm the ingest queue is drained first. One gotcha: Quellhorn signs its ack callbacks, so the env file needs the HMAC secret before the pods will pass readiness. Add it right here:

secret setting of yajog-taguf: ARCHIVE_KEY3=051

Subject: Ledgerlens key rotation — heads up for the sync

Quick note before Thursday's eng sync: we're rotating the API key for Ledgerlens, the audit-log viewer. Old key stops working Friday noon, so update any dashboards or scripts that query it directly. Scopes and endpoints are unchanged — just swap the secret. To save everyone a lookup, the new key is below.

API key for yahig-tadup: kto7_ubizbYm